Milan Hilderink

Milan Hilderink (born 29 September 2002) is a Dutch professional footballer who plays as a defender for Eerste Divisie club De Graafschap.[1]

Club career

In 2019, Hilderink signed a two-year professional contract with De Graafschap.[2] He made his professional debut on 23 August 2019 in the match against FC Volendam after replacing Gregor Breinburg in the 83th minute.[3]

Hilderink signed another contract extension in August 2021, keeping him part of De Graafschap until 2023.[4]
